The 1924 Immigration Act, also known as the Johnson-Reed Act, established national origins quotas and significantly restricted immigration from many parts of the world. While many of its provisions are no longer in effect, understanding its historical context can illuminate the evolution of US immigration policy. An H1B immigration lawyer assists applicants in Elgin by guiding them through the complex process of securing a specialty occupation visa. This includes advising employers on eligibility requirements, preparing and filing the Labor Condition Application (LCA), and managing the H1B petition with USCIS. They ensure all documentation is accurate and submitted by the crucial deadlines, maximizing the chances of a successful petition for skilled foreign workers.

An immigration office, such as a USCIS field office, handles a range of services including interviews for naturalization and adjustment of status, fingerprinting appointments, and providing information on immigration processes.
